On October 22 2011 06:12 Whitewing wrote:
Show nested quote +
On October 22 2011 06:09 On_Slaught wrote:
200/200 is a lot more than I was expecting the Replicator to cost... holy hell that is a lot for a unit which can only steal a single unit and which has very low hp apparently.

150/200 for the Oracle, and having it come from the Stargate instead of the robo, is nice imo. I like the cost, the abilities and the location so far.



It has to be more expensive then other units you can build, or else you can just spam them and copy your own units.

Could just make it so you can't copy your own units with it.

Not much point in having it being able to copy own units, as it creates balance problems if you can just use it to mass tech-switch all at once.

With the 200/200 cost and build time, there is almost nothing that is worth replicating. Even an SCV isn't worth it as you need such an investment, making a CC and a rax just to get mules, plus the replicator cost and time investment. And you lose out on the free nexus abilities you could have had instead.

It's not like the mind control was really used in BW, despite being permanent, removing the unit from your opponent as well as being reusable and usable on all types of units. So yeah, with 200/200, it will likely go down the Dark archon-route of rarely being used except for extreme late game.
